Andru Posted March 16, 2011 Posted March 16, 2011 As you were saying I believe she greatly requires a beam or projectile multi hit assist to be good. That and an OTG. I feel Wesker is a godlike pair with her (Go figure) Because of OTG properties, mixup, and the DHC glitch. The "RE5" team isn't actually a bad team either, everyone builds good meter for each other. Chris highly benefits off of her wallbounce assist is what I heard. Or just throw sentinel drones on that shit as your 3rd and profit, forcing them to block her mixup. She can stay safe with feral cancels. She has a command grab (You can actually combo grab B into grab A if you wavedash at them) I feel her level 3 should be comboed into , into her infinite. Although I won't do it, unless she's the last one or I don't have Wesker. I could easily BNB into DHC - Wesker to kill someone. Machine Gun hyper has 20 frames of invuln and works best midscreen, it also hits people out of their hypers a lot. I wouldn't use it too much..especially not for getting in. I think once she gets in it's going to be very hard to push her out. Special kicks , if blocked, cancelled into feral cancel = frame advantage. Forcing them to block another teleport mixup which, I'm pretty sure, they have to respect. In any case she's still new and things are still being figured out..I think she seems solid as of now.

SolxBaiken Posted March 18, 2011 Posted March 18, 2011 jill is very assist reliant tbh i feel that she is the kind of character that needs a wall jump/double jump/air dash, or at least feral dash mid air Very much so, she would've benefited greatly from any of those things, I'm actually shocked they gave her crap movements options compared to Wesker (seeing how they're essentially on the same level in RE5) and I'm also shocked at the lack of gun-play :< would've been nice for her to have a projectile (that's not a hyper). Also what Machine Gun Spray lacks is damage and hit consistency it makes up for in pure awesome, this is pretty much the ultimate escape since the first 20 frames are invincible pretty much nothing get get her even at late activation (I once escaped Ryu's Shin Hadouken even through I was already being blasted = w=). It's also godly in DHC should you make a bad call. I actually now have less love for Raven Spike as you really do need to be comboing to guarantee a hit, otherwise 8/10 you're just wasting meter. Jill is more complicated than Shuma, it's going to take longer for people to figure her out. Jill's not so much more complicated as she just needs alot more than most of the cast does, like for approaching she needs a good projectile assist (right now I'm running Shuma/Jill/Filicia and mystic ray assist into 236+H is great seeing how it can't be punished least you get hit by one of them since mystic is "delayed" since it swipes)
